Tuition Fees

Tuition for online doctoral programs in early childhood education varies widely. On average, you might find programs ranging from $15,000 to $30,000 for the entire degree. Some universities in Georgia offer competitive rates, making them attractive options for local students.

Additional Expenses

Besides tuition, consider other costs such as:

  • Books and materials: These can add up, so budget accordingly.
  • Technology fees: Online programs may charge for access to platforms and resources.
  • Travel costs: If your program requires on-campus visits, factor in travel expenses.

FAQs

1. What is an online doctoral program in early childhood education?
It’s a graduate-level program that prepares professionals for leadership, policy, research, or advanced teaching roles in early childhood education, delivered primarily or fully online.

2. What types of doctoral degrees are offered in this field?
You can pursue a Doctor of Education (EdD) or a Doctor of Philosophy (PhD). EdD programs often focus on practice and leadership, while PhDs are more research-intensive.

3. How long does it take to complete an online doctorate in early childhood education?
Most programs take 3 to 5 years, depending on transfer credits, course load, and dissertation requirements.

4. Are online doctoral programs respected by employers?
Yes, as long as the program is accredited and from a reputable institution, online doctorates are widely accepted and respected.

5. Do I need to complete a dissertation?
Most PhD and many EdD programs require a dissertation or final capstone project, though some EdD programs offer alternative research projects.

6. Can I work while enrolled in an online doctoral program?
Yes, these programs are often designed for working professionals, offering flexible schedules and asynchronous coursework.
